
编程的 AI 的基本概念
快速发展的科技时代,编程的 AI正逐渐成为一种重要的工具,它不仅影响着软件开发的效率,还深刻改变了我们对学习和教育的理解。简单来说,编程的 AI 是一种使用人工智能技术来生成、优化或辅助编写代码的系统或工具。与传统编程方式相比,编程的 AI 可以在更短的时间内完成更复杂的任务,它通过学习大量代码和开发历史,利用模式识别技术,来建议最佳的编程解决方案。
编程的 AI 结合了深度学习、自然语言处理和知识图谱等前沿技术,使其在理解和生成代码方面变得愈发精准。通过对各类编程语言语法和逻辑的理解,编程 AI 不仅可以帮助开发者提高工作效率,还可以为新手提供学习编程的辅助工具,甚至在代码审查和优化过程中起到推动作用。
例如,编程的 AI 可以为开发者自动生成代码、进行代码优化、错误检测以及提供即时反馈。通过利用这些先进的工具,开发者能够更专注于实际的设计和逻辑构建,而不是被繁琐的代码细节所困扰。这一过程不仅提高了编程的效率,也降低了开发过程中的错误率,为项目的顺利推进提供了保障。
回顾过去的几年,AI 编程工具的快速发展使得编程变得更加普及。无论是专业开发人员,还是初学者,都能够利用这些工具提升自己的技能水平。这些 AI 工具可以通过提供代码示例、自动补全、语法检查等功能,帮助用户在编程过程中减少学习曲线,实现快速上手。
可以说,编程的 AI 提供了一种全新的编程范式,使得编程在教育、开发和自动化等领域展现出更大的潜力。随着技术的不断进步,编程的 AI 在未来将会进一步改变软件开发的游戏规则。
编程的 AI 在教育中的应用
编程的 AI 在教育中具有不可忽视的影响。它提供了一种创新的学习方式,使学生能够以更直观和互动的方式学习编程。在传统教育中,学习编程往往需要花费大量时间去掌握语法和逻辑,而借助 AI 工具,学生可以获得实时的反馈和建议,从而加快学习速度。例如,一些智能编程学习平台可以依据每个学生的学习进度和能力,自动调整教材和练习内容,这种个性化学习体验有效提升了学习效果。
编程的 AI 能够模拟真实的编程环境,通过实际项目案例提升学生的实战能力。这种模拟环境可以让学生在实际编码时遇到类似真实项目的挑战,这不仅增强了他们的解决问题的能力,还提高了他们的团队合作意识。过程中,编程的 AI 可以为学生提供代码审核、性能评估等反馈,让他们在实践中不断改进和提高。
此外,编程 AI 的使用还促进了编程教育的普及。许多地区和学校开始使用这些 AI 工具来进行编程课程的教学。因为编程的 AI 对于教学的辅助作用大大降低了教师的工作压力,让他们可以更专注于辅导学生和改进教学内容。教育者可以利用这些工具获取学生的学习数据和行为分析,从而及时调整教学策略,确保每个学生都能在适合自己的节奏下更有效地学习。
在未来,随着技术的发展和普及,编程的 AI 在教育中的应用将更加广泛。AI 不仅可以为教师和学生提供高效的教学支持,还将推动整个教育体系的变革,帮助更多的人享受到便捷的编程学习体验。通过将人工智能技术融入教育领域,编程的 AI 将为我们培养出更多优秀的编程人才。
常见问题解答
编程的 AI 能做什么?
编程的 AI 能够完成多种任务,为开发者和学习者提供显著的便利。它可以生成代码示例。当用户输入某个功能需求时,AI 能够快速生成相应的代码片段,帮助开发者节省时间。编程的 AI 具备错误检测的能力,一旦代码出现错误,AI可以实时标识出错误位置并提出修复建议。此外,编程的 AI 还能够进行代码审查,评估代码的性能和优化建议,帮助开发者提升代码质量。
在学习方面,编程的 AI 提供实时反馈,学生在编写代码时,可以立即获得语法检查与逻辑提示,这样不仅可以改善学习体验,还可以加速掌握编程技能。同时,AI 学习平台会根据学生的学习进度推荐适合的课程和练习,有效地避免了学习资源的浪费。总的来说,编程的 AI 在代码生成、错误检测、代码审查及个性化学习等方面都具备显著的应用价值。
编程AI如何提升开发效率?
编程的 AI 通过多种方式帮助开发者提升效率。借助 AI 的即时建议功能,开发者在编写代码时能够获得上下文相关的提示。这意味着在开发过程中可以减少停顿时间,提高工作流的连贯性。编程的 AI 可在代码重复性工作上大显身手,自动完成常见功能的插入,极大地降低了开发者的工作负担。此外,编程的 AI 还具备学习和适应的能力,能够根据开发者的编码风格进行优化,这有助于进一步提升编码效率。
最值得注意的是,编程的 AI 在整个软件开发周期中都能发挥作用。无论是需求分析、设计、编码还是测试,AI 工具都能为开发团队提供支撑,确保项目进度的顺利推进。通过高效地组织和处理代码,编程的 AI 能有效降低错误率,提高软件质量,为企业节省了大量的时间和资源。
AI 编程对初学者的优势有哪些?
AI 编程工具为初学者创造了一个友好且高效的学习环境。用户友好的界面和实时反馈机制,使初学者能够在实践中快速纠正错误。传统的编程学习往往让人感到棘手,而 AI 的即时反馈可以显著降低学习的门槛。AI 编程工具为初学者提供了大量的学习资源和项目实践,通过真实案例的分析,帮助他们逐步理解抽象的概念。
另外,AI 能根据学习者的进度提供个性化的建议与提高方案,从而实现高效学习。这样的个性化学习路径不仅可以帮助初学者快速提升技能,还能培养他们的自信心,使之在学习过程中保持兴趣与热情。总的来说,AI 编程工具为初学者创造了一个积极的学习氛围,同时极大地方便了他们的问题解决能力的提高。
未来编程的 AI 将如何发展?
未来,编程的 AI 将继续在多方面发展,提升其在软件开发和教育中的应用效益。技术的进步使得 AI 的学习能力更加强大。通过深入学习和自我强化,AI 将能够生成更加复杂的代码,并提供更全面的建议。编程的 AI 将与其他技术深度融合,比如区块链和云计算,从而在软件开发的各个层面实现更高的效率和更优的质量。
此外,随着企业和教育机构的逐渐普及,编程的 AI 还将推动更加灵活的教学方法和学习体验。AI 将帮助教师设计课程内容,同时也能根据学生的学习进度进行灵活调整。总之,编程的 AI 在未来的应用场景将愈加广泛和深入,推动软件开发领域的变革和教育的转型。
编程的 AI 的重要性
编程的 AI 不仅是当今技术发展的产物,也是未来软件开发和教育的重要组成部分。其在提升开发效率、个性化学习和降低入门门槛等诸多方面的优势,使得编程的 AI 成为不可或缺的工具。随着技术的不断成熟,编程的 AI 将能够更好地满足不断变化的市场需求,并为更多的开发者和学习者提供支持。
在教育领域,编程的 AI 正在改变传统的学习方式,为学生提供了更为便捷的解决方案。通过提升学习体验和学习效果,编程的 AI 有望在未来培养出更多的优秀编程人才,促进整个社会的科技进步。正因此,深入理解编程的 AI 概念及其广泛应用,将使我们快速发展的时代中把握住先机,迎接未来挑战。
本文内容通过AI工具智能整合而成,仅供参考,普元不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系普元进行反馈,普元收到您的反馈后将及时答复和处理。
